Chronicles Alumni Joe Burgstaller (1993 BM) joined the prestigious ensemble, Canadian Brass, in Summer 2001. He is a former student of David Hickman. Joel de la Houssaye (1997 BMT) presented with Barbara Crowe at the American Music Therapy Association conference on "Group Percussion Experiences as an Intervention for Gang Involvement: Music Therapy in Schools." Robin M. Georgion (2001 BFA), is the Development Event Manager with The Atlanta Opera. E-mail address is: rgbass@hotmail.com. She is a former student of Daniel Swaim. Percussionist Michael Kenyon (year BM, year MM) has been named Executive Director of the Percussive Arts Society, effective August 1, 2001. Prior to the appointment, Kenyon was Executive Director of the New Mexico Jazz Workshop. Eun Mi Kwak (1998 BMT) has established a private music therapy clinic in Seoul, South Korea. She presented at the 2001 American Music Therapy Association conference on "Rhythmic Auditory Stimulation (RAS) Gail Training for Improving Velocity and Gait Symmetry." Tracy Leonard-Warner (1994 BMT) is the current president of the Western Region of American Music Therapy Association. Congratulations to James O'Halloran (2000 Instrumental Music Education) whose comments were featured in an article for the August issue of B&O: Band and Orchestra Product News. The school at which O'Halloran teaches, Barry Goldwater High School in Phoenix, received $30,000 worth of prizes for its music program due to the winning of an easy writing contest on "How Music Education has Enriched My Life" by one of the students. Kathleen Walsh (1996 BMT) is the current president of the Arizona Music Therapy Association. David Jenkins (2001 MM) is teaching saxophone at the University of Massachusetts during Spring 2002.
